To change the side indicator bulb on a Vauxhall Corsa, first, ensure the vehicle is turned off and the keys are removed. Locate the indicator light assembly, typically found on the front fender or rear light cluster. Gently twist or unclip the assembly to access the bulb holder, then remove the old bulb by pulling it straight out. Insert the new bulb, ensuring it's securely in place, and reassemble the indicator light assembly before testing the new bulb.

The near side front indicator bulb for a Vauxhall Corsa is typically a PY21W bulb. However, it's always best to check your vehicle's manual or consult with an auto parts retailer to confirm the exact bulb type, as specifications may vary by model year.
To replace the back indicator bulb on a Vauxhall Corsa 1.2, first, open the rear hatch and locate the tail light assembly. Remove the screws or clips securing the assembly and carefully pull it out. Twist the bulb holder counterclockwise to remove it, then pull out the old bulb and replace it with a new one. Reassemble the tail light by reversing the steps, ensuring everything is securely fastened.

To change the headlight bulb on a 1998-2000 Vauxhall Corsa, start by opening the bonnet and locating the back of the headlight assembly. Remove the rubber cover and disconnect the bulb's electrical connector. Twist the old bulb counterclockwise to remove it, then insert the new bulb, ensuring not to touch the glass with your fingers. Reconnect the electrical connector and replace the rubber cover before closing the bonnet.

To change the indicator bulb on a Vauxhall Vectra, first, ensure the vehicle is turned off and the keys are removed. Open the hood and locate the headlight assembly; you may need to remove any covers or screws. Twist the bulb holder counterclockwise to release it, then pull out the old bulb and replace it with a new one, ensuring not to touch the glass of the new bulb with your fingers. Finally, reassemble everything and test the indicator to make sure it’s working.
